Solution Overview

Problem

The traditional separation of household functions and the increasing trend of using consumer electronic devices in non-traditional rooms require a solution to seamlessly integrate these devices with existing appliances, enabling flexible and versatile functionality.

Innovation Solution

A modular system comprising a host appliance, a consumer electronic device, and an adapter that provides services such as power and data communication, while also offering additional functionalities like user interfaces, storage, and media management, allowing for removability and versatility in device placement.

Data Source

PatentUS7765332B2Functional adapter for a consumer electronic device
Publication Date: 2010.07.27 WHIRLPOOL CORP

AI summary

A modular system comprising a host, a consumer electronic device, and an adapter coupling the consumer electronic device to the host. The adapter performs a first function of supplying at least one service provided by one of the host and the consumer electronic device to the other of the host and the consumer electronic device, and a second function. The second function can be different from the first function. The second function can be unrelated to the supply of a service.
